Personal Life - Pamela Bach and David Hasselhoff
One of the most talked-about aspects of Pamela Bach's life was her marriage to David Hasselhoff. The couple wed in 1984 and shared nearly 20 years together before divorcing in 2003. They welcomed two daughters, Hayley and Taylor Hasselhoff, who have also pursued careers in entertainment. Their relationship was often in the public eye, and while it had its ups and downs, it was clear that they cared deeply for one another. In fact, Hasselhoff expressed his grief over Bach's passing, highlighting the bond they once shared.
